Oracle Succession Planning Predefined Components

This topic lists the predefined responsibility, menus, and functions supplied with Oracle Succession Planning.

Predefined Responsibilities

Oracle Succession Planning supplies the following predefined responsibilities:

Succession Planning

The corresponding menu is Succession Planning (HR_SUCCESSION_MGMT) menu. The following table lists the functions available with the menu.

These responsibilities are provided as a starting point only. If you need to change the responsibility or menu you must create your own using the predefined responsibility and menu as examples. Otherwise, your changes may be lost during an upgrade.

Talent Profile Menus

Talent Profile helps enterprises to obtain a complete picture of the talent profile of their workforce on a single-interface.

Talent Profile Based on Role Requirements

As managers and workers have different business requirements, Talent Profile delivers views based on their roles. For example, only managers can view the Succession Plans region, compare talent profiles, and use performance matrixes.

To meet the different talent requirements, Oracle Succession Planning delivers the following Talent Profile Menus:

Menu Description
Talent Profile Manager Access Menu (HR_TP_MGR_MENU) Enables managers to access Talent Profile functions that include Compare Profiles and view Performance Matrix (Potential) and Performance Matrix (Retention). Managers can view talent profiles of workers in their supervisor hierarchy.
Talent Profile Employee Access Menu (HR_TP_EMP_MENU) Enables workers to view their talent profiles.
Suitability Matching Spider Menu (HR_SUIT_MATCH_SPIDER_MENU) Launches the Suitability Analyzer tool and enables competency-based search.
Menu For All Seeded Report Template Functions (HR_TP_TEMPLATES_MENU) Enables managers to generate the compare profile reports of a single worker, two workers, or three workers. Managers can also print the talent profile of a worker.
The reports are generated in the Adobe Acrobat PDF format.
Talent Profile Launch Menu (HR_TP_LAUNCH_MENU) Launches the Talent Profile page.

Talent Matrix Menu

Talent Matrix is a flexible and configurable tool that helps enterprises to define succession planning dimensions as per their business requirements. To assess succession potential of their workforce, plan administrators can create different talent matrix templates for use in their enterprise, based on the delivered talent matrix types and combinations of X and Y axes dimensions.

The Talent Matrix tool is not displayed in the application, by default. If required, system administrators must enable this tool by completing additional implementation steps. See: Enabling Talent Matrix

Succession Planning Approval Workflow Process

The Succession Planning Approval Process (HR_SP_APPROVAL_PRC) governs approvals in Oracle Succession Planning. This process is available in the HRSSA item type (HRSSA.wft) and routes the succession plans for approval and generates notifications.
